Given the attached graph below, it is clear that the right angle triangle ABC is shown.

Here are some of the information we can get from the right angle triangle ABC such as:

  • The angle at C = 30°
  • side AB = 8 units

We have to determine the unknown side 'x' using the trigonometric ratios

As

tan Ф = opp/adjacent

From the diagram it is clear that

Ф = 30°

opp=8

adjacent = BC = x

so

tan Ф = opp/adjacent

tan 30 = 8/x

1/√3 = 8/x

x = 8×√3

x = 13.9

Therefore, the missing length will be: x = 13.9

The sum of four consecutive even integers is -28
mina [271]
I guess you want to find the 4 numbers

x + x + 2 + x + 4 + x + 6 = -28
4x + 12 = - 28
4x =  - 40
x = -10

so the numbers are -10, -8, -6 ,-4.
